基于邮轮用户体验的移动信息服务设计研究

摘    要:目的 提出针对邮轮信息服务平台的构建策略,以用户信息旅程图、服务系统图、服务蓝图等可视化手段,展现当代邮轮信息服务系统的工作机制。方法 基于大型邮轮课题的研究现状,以用户体验模型、移动信息相关理论及服务设计为基础,问题为导向,通过交叉学科的研究方法,运用可用性测试方法对产品满意度进行评估,验证该设计方法对提升用户体验的有效性。结论 得出移动信息服务设计策略模型,引入服务设计思维并提出具体的设计流程,并对系统中的关键接触点给出优化建议。

关 键 词:数字化邮轮  用户体验  移动信息  服务设计

Mobile Information Service Design Based on Cruise User Experience

Abstract:This paper aims to propose a strategy for construction of cruise information service platform to present the working mechanism of the contemporary cruise information service system through visualization methods of user information journey, service system map and service blueprint. Based on the research background of large-scale cruise project, user experience model, mobile information related theory and service design, and guided by problems, the cross-disciplinary research method and usability test were used to evaluate the product satisfaction and verify the effectiveness of the design method on improvement of user experience. The mobile information service design strategy model is obtained. The service design thinking is introduced. The specific design process is proposed. And suggestions on optimization of key contact points in the system were given.
Keywords:digital cruise  user experience  mobile information  service design
